Widely credited as the founder of New York City’s barbecue movement, Blue Smoke celebrates the evolving American South while honoring its culinary traditions. Executive Chef Jean-Paul Bourgeois’ menu combines home-style comfort with culinary finesse. Classic and specialty cocktails, an extensive American craft beer list, bourbon and American wines complete the experience.
The flagship Blue Smoke, with the club Jazz Standard, is located on East 27th Street in New York City, and a second location opened in 2012 in NYC’s Battery Park City. Blue Smoke also has two premium Blue Smoke On The Road baseball concessions at Citi Field, home of the New York Mets, and the Washington Nationals ballpark. In 2013, Blue Smoke On The Road opened at Delta Terminal 4 in John F. Kennedy International Airport.
